ASW | Adult & Youth Case Manager
Wichita, KS $37,099 - $52,099 a year
Join a compassionate team as an Adult & Youth Case Manager providing direct community-based mental health and applied behavior analysis services. This role focuses on supporting children and adults facing significant mental health and social challenges by delivering evidence-based interventions in home, school, or community settings.
Key Responsibilities- Implement skill training aligned with treatment goals using evidence-based practices, with measurable outcomes determined by qualified professionals.
- Follow treatment plans developed by BCBA/Autism Specialists and participate in regular supervision and training sessions.
- Deliver intensive, interactive mental health and behavioral services using a strengths-based, skill-building approach.
- Collaborate with families and treatment teams to develop and maintain client-centered treatment plans.
- Support clients and families in understanding symptoms and exploring solutions, while facilitating connections to natural community supports.
- Coordinate mental and physical healthcare services and maintain communication among clients, providers, families, and community partners.
- Required:
Bachelor's degree in Social Work, Psychology, or related field; or Associate's degree plus 2+ years of relevant experience; or equivalent combination totaling 4+ years. - Preferred:
Bachelor's degree in Social Work, Sociology, Psychology, or Special Education with specialized training in human development and family dynamics. - 3-5 years of professional experience in mental health or related services is preferred.
- Completion of CPST Case Management online training, KHS online training, and passing background checks including KBI, child and adult abuse registries, and motor vehicle screening.
- Completion of state-required Adult Mental Health Case Management training within 60 days of hire.
- Completion of Intensive Individual Support training within 6 months of hire.
- Valid driver's license, insurance, and reliable vehicle required.
- Strong organizational and communication skills with proficiency in Microsoft Office.
- Ability to work autonomously with flexibility and accountability.
- Compassionate, respectful, and customer-service oriented approach.
- Conflict management skills and ability to collaborate with diverse populations.
- Leadership capabilities including coaching, process improvement, and strategic thinking.
This position serves a diverse population in a regional area of the United States, offering a meaningful opportunity to impact lives through dedicated mental health support.
